**FAQ: Why is the FuelTrace fleet report vault-sealed?**

For security review: the monthly FuelTrace report aggregates raw pump logs from the Western depot fleet, which include route data we classify as sensitive. The report archive is therefore sealed and opened only during audits, with each access recorded.

To unseal the archive, auditors enter the recovery passphrase provided below.

vault phrase of fahog-yajof = istael-zorwyn

**Action Item PM-412: Harden Fabrikit test-data factories.** During the Ledgerline outage, stale fixtures from Fabrikit masked a schema mismatch for three days. New team members: never hand-roll test records; use Fabrikit builders so schema checks run automatically. Owner: Tova on the Platform Reliability squad. Due end of next sprint. Scope: add schema validation on factory output, fail CI on drift, and deprecate the legacy seed scripts. Questions go to the #fabrikit channel. Full context and rollout plan live on the internal wiki page here.

runbook for badug-kadup: https://confluence.zemvarlabs.internal/projects/browse/display/projects/bd1b

Internal Memo — to Sales Leads

Quick heads-up: warranty costs on the Braylock T2 mowers have blown past forecast — roughly 30% over, mostly gearbox returns. Please don't promise extended coverage to close deals until we've fixed the reserve position. Keep pushing the T3 where you can. Engineering expects a fix by quarter-end. The plan going forward is noted below.

board note of yajog-bagaf: Headcount on the Druvan team goes from 24 to 132 by the end of August. Gross margin on Druvan came in at 23 percent against a plan of 3 percent.

Subject: Q3 Regional Sales Review — Eastvale Territory

Team,

The Q3 review for the Eastvale region is complete. Revenue came in at 4% below forecast, driven mainly by slower uptake of the Corvalen product line in the Harwick district. Pipeline coverage for Q4 sits at 2.1x, which Marta Huelsen considers adequate but thin. Finance should reconcile the discount ledger before the month-end close. Full workbook to follow. One item is not for distribution beyond this group.

board note of bawep-tajef: Queniusek Systems plans to raise the Quenvan list price by 53.1 percent in March. The pricing group signed off on a budget of $176.4 million for Project Drueth. The renewal with Casionix Partners closes at $142.5 million a year, 8.3 percent below the last contract. Project Fraax slips by six weeks because of the tooling delay.